The hexadecimal color code #CAB179 corresponds to the code RGB( 202, 177, 121 ). It's a shade of Orange. This color is a combination of red (at 0,79 level), green (at 0,69 level) and blue (at 0,47 level). Its brightness is 63% and its saturation is 43%. It is composed of red at 40%, green at 35% and blue at 24%.

The complementary color #354E86 is the color exactly opposite to #CAB179 on the color wheel. The triadic palette is created by selecting two colors that are evenly spaced on the color wheel.

Uses of #CAB179 in CSS

When using #CAB179 as the background color, consider selecting a darker text color for improved readability. If you want to use #CAB179 as the text color, prefer a dark background, such as Black.
